Longest and shortest day in Penang
In Penang, Malaysia, the longest day of 2026 is around the June solstice on Sunday, 21 June 2026, with 12h 26m of daylight, and the shortest is around the December solstice on Monday, 21 December 2026, with 11h 49m.
| Turning point | Date | Sunrise | Sunset | Day length |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| March equinox | Friday, 20 March 2026 | 07:23 | 19:29 | 12h 6m |
| June solstice | Sunday, 21 June 2026 | 07:07 | 19:33 | 12h 26m |
| September equinox | Tuesday, 22 September 2026 | 07:08 | 19:14 | 12h 7m |
| December solstice | Monday, 21 December 2026 | 07:22 | 19:10 | 11h 49m |

Why the day gets longer and shorter in Penang
Earth's axis is tilted about 23.4 degrees, so as the planet orbits the Sun, Penang leans toward the Sun for part of the year and away for the rest. When it leans toward the Sun the days lengthen and the Sun climbs higher; half a year later the opposite happens. The size of the swing depends on how far Penang sits from the equator: the further away, the bigger the difference between the longest and shortest day.

How much does day length change through the year in Penang?
Between the longest and shortest day, Penang gains and loses about 0h 37m of daylight. The change is fastest around the March and September equinoxes and slowest near the solstices.
